Will you be returning to the Spiritwalker trilogy, or will that be a standalone trilogy? Likewise, will you be returning to the Spirit Gate trilogy? I enjoyed both immensely and I think there is a lot of material that you could potentially cover in both the Spiritwalker and Spirit Gate trilogies that you didn't explore in the first three books. --Tomas
Kate Elliott
Tomas, thank you for the great question. I'm so pleased you enjoyed both series.
Spiritwalker is a standalone trilogy. At the moment I have no plans to write another novel in that world although that doesn't mean I will never will. I have written a few shorter pieces and have several more partly written, and which I will most post online.
The Spirit Gate trilogy is also meant as a standalone trilogy. However I have more to say about that world, and in fact Black Wolves, coming this November, is probably pretty much exactly what you are hoping for.
